T-Pain Drives Ford F-650 Truck to V103 Car and Bike Show

T-Pain was one of the artists invited to show off their hundred-thousand-dollar rides, last weekend, for the 11th annual V-103 Car and Bike show. Two-wheeled masterpieces, tricked out paint jobs and some of the craziest cars from all over the south were present at Atlanta’s World Congress Center Hall, on Saturday.

Put together by famous Atlanta-based DJ Greg Street, the 11th annual V-103 Car and Bike show once again brought the noise and beauty in one place. Having close friends and celebrities like T.I. Da Brat, Rich Homie Quan on the list, one of the artists also present at the event was T-Pain.

And this is quite the event where you’ll want to brag with the best ride you can get out of your garage. At least, that is what most of those happy folks driving jewels on wheels think about. But we all know T-Pain always wants to have fun and enjoy any moment of his life, so of course he took the craziest of his collection.

As long as we can figure out, this huge truck is the Ford F-650. This regularly means we’re talking about construction fields, commercial trucks, towing, heavy hauling or whatever sort of utilitarian use. Well, it’s not the case for rappers, that just love to take enormous trucks or really big vans and pimp them up to look like living rooms on wheels.
